Self-Capacitance of Coil Formula Elements

Variables
Coil Self Capacitance
Coil Self Capacitance refers to the inherent capacitance that exists between the turns of wire in a coil or inductor.
Symbol: Cself
Measurement: CapacitanceUnit: F
Note: Value should be greater than 0.
Additional Capacitance
Additional Capacitance is defined as is the ratio of the amount of electric charge stored on a conductor to a difference in electric potential.
Symbol: Ca
Measurement: CapacitanceUnit: F
Note: Value should be greater than 0.
Voltmeter Capacitance
Voltmeter Capacitance refers to the inherent capacitance present in a voltmeter due to its construction and design.
Symbol: Cv
Measurement: CapacitanceUnit: F
Note: Value should be greater than 0.
